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, if he will take steps to introduce training bonds for dentists who train at English universities to require them to work in the NHS for a set period of time.

This question was answered on 1st March 2023

We have no plans to introduce training bonds for dentists who train at English universities.

The National Health Service contracts with independent dental providers to deliver NHS dental treatment in primary care settings. As a result, pay and conditions are agreed between staff and the practice holding an NHS contract, providing practices with the flexibility to recruit to meet local needs.
